Output 10b4cab3d529534e43be712b78c317ae4c72e425fa5d427375929936449d78bd:2

value
330760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 838fc60179e9dd6339586322500221fb9768f51b OP_EQUAL
address
3DgegEDVvNVK6p6eYpcd3am7kyNqNTF5NX
transaction
10b4cab3d529534e43be712b78c317ae4c72e425fa5d427375929936449d78bd
confirmations
330960
spent
true